Output 71c4c52c42a503aa5cf4e2bb5dbfcdefd2d9c4c4dd197cdf5aa06a88ec0c07db:17

value
2697031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27eb87814aa887eca129dfc70efe803555dd39be OP_EQUAL
address
35L6RtWgp22XfKLNFHx9LqGMX9iopnHBMq
transaction
71c4c52c42a503aa5cf4e2bb5dbfcdefd2d9c4c4dd197cdf5aa06a88ec0c07db
confirmations
426666
spent
true